How much does an Operating Systems Development Manager make in Connecticut? The average Operating Systems Development Manager salary in Connecticut is $169,200 as of March 26, 2024, but the range typically falls between $152,600 and $185,200.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on the city and many other important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ession.

Job Description

The Operating Systems Development Manager develops policies and procedures related to the deployment and maintenance of the organization's operating systems. Oversees a staff responsible for the development, installation, and modification of computer operating systems. Being an Operating Systems Development Manager requires a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Explores the future operating system needs of the organization and provides technical leadership to the operating team. In addition, Operating Systems Development Manager typically reports to top management. The Operating Systems Development Manager typ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. Working as an Operating Systems Development Manager typ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
